New report says water related outdoor recreation adds 3 billion to economy in Yavapai and Coconino Counties.

Audubon Arizona recently released a study on the economic impact of water related outdoor recreation in Yavapai and Coconino counties. The report shows an average of 545,000 residents participate in water related outdoor recreation creating an annual economic impact of $3 billion. The study also found water based recreation in both counties generates a combined 26,400 jobs. The report says, as a whole, Arizona’s waterways are enjoyed by more than 1.5 million residents each year and contribute $13.5 billion to the state’s economy while supporting 114,000 jobs.
